问题内容: 我有一个字段和一个具有相同名称的局部变量。如何进入该领域? 码: 在c ++中使用::运算符,如下所示: 是Java中的::运算符吗? 问题答案: 那不是全局变量,而是实例变量。只需使用: (有关的含义,请参见JLS第15.8.3节。) 对于 静态 变量(人们在谈论全局变量时通常指的是 静态 变量),您可以使用类名来限定变量名: 在大多数情况下,我宁愿不要使用与实例或静态变量同名的局部
如果我在我的类中创建一个bool,就像一样,它默认为false。 当我在我的方法中创建相同的bool时,我得到一个错误“使用未分配的局部变量检查”。为什么?
我正在尝试从pojo创建一个函数,该函数在以下意义上使用细节类值的求和: 但是不知道为什么这一行< code > sum = sum . add(detail . getvalue());引发此错误: 从lambda表达式引用的局部变量必须是final或有效final 你能告诉我我做错了什么吗?谢了。
在Java10中,我们可以使用类型推断。
因此,我尝试使用ByteBuddy的能力来创建可以从@Advice.onMethodEnter保留到@Advice.onMethodExit的局部变量。这将允许我在方法enter上创建OpenTracing跨度,并在方法Exit上完成它。不过,我不确定我的用例是否有效,因为我使用的是一个转换器,它与@advice.local注释的测试用例不完全匹配。 我试图遵循这个测试用例中使用的语法。 但是,s
:我知道如何: 运行不带参数的私有void方法 :我知道如何: 设置任意类型的私有字段 设置任意类型的私有静态字段 设置任意类型的私有最终字段 设置任意类型的私有静态最终字段 :我知道如何: 获取任何类型的私有字段 :我知道如何: (可用于以单模式创建私有构造函数的新实例,同时保持实例Field为空) 创建不带参数的私有构造函数的新实例 我不知道的,我想知道的: 获取任何类型的私有静态字段,并将其
问题内容: 好吧,考虑下面给出的不可变类: 现在,我正在一个类中创建一个对象,该对象的对象将由多个线程共享: 看到as 并移入同步块并创建对象。现在,由于 Java内存模型(JMM)允许多个线程在初始化开始之后但尚未结束之前观察对象。 因此,可以将写入操作视为在写入的字段之前发生。因此,因此可以看到部分构造,该构造很可能处于无效状态,并且其状态以后可能会意外更改。 它不是非线程安全的吗? 编辑 好
在Quarkus和小黑麦叛变案中工作,我不知道如何处理赔偿。 我有一份员工名单,我必须更新数据库中的所有员工。数据访问对象(EmployeeDao)具有以下方法:
类OneValueCache是不可变的。但是我们可以更改变量缓存的引用。 但我不能理解为什么VolateCachedFactorizer类是线程安全的。 对于两个线程(线程A和线程B),如果线程A和线程B同时到达,那么两个线程A和B都将尝试创建OnEvalueCache。然后线程A到达而线程B同时到达。然后线程A将创建一个,它覆盖threadB创建的值(OneValueChange是不可变的,但是
问题内容: 我开始为我的项目研究elasticsearch。特别是1.5版。我正在考虑使用别名从复杂的索引设置中提取客户端应用程序。我最终可能会得到20到50个索引,每个索引10到30个别名。这将等于1500个别名。 我想知道每个索引和/或每个群集的别名数是否有限制。 提前致谢, P. 问题答案: 在Elasticsearch源代码中,我看到别名被引用为。Java中的数组似乎有很大的大小,我不用担
问题内容: 背景和详细信息 Swift进化建议SE-0094在Swift 3.0中实现,引入了全局功能: 后者声明如下 并在swift / stdlib / public / core / UnfoldSequence.swift中实现 。语言参考提供了以下使用它的示例(请注意,缺少显式类型注释) { iters in iters.0 = !iters.0 return iters.0 ? ite
问题内容: ackson具有使用以下命令忽略类中未知属性的注释: 它允许你使用以下注释忽略特定属性: 如果要全局设置,可以修改对象映射器: 你如何使用spring对其进行全局设置,以便在服务器启动时无需编写其他类? 问题答案: 对于杰克逊1.9x或更低版本,你可以使用对象映射器提供程序忽略未知属性 For jackson 1.9x及更高版本,你可以使用对象映射器提供程序忽略未知属性 Spring不
问题内容: 我根据以下条件在MANY Spring-MVC控制器中使用以下自定义编辑器: 控制器 其他控制器 另一个控制器 注意注册了相同的自定义编辑器 问题:如何设置像这样的全局自定义编辑器以避免设置每个控制器? 问题答案: 你需要在你的应用程序上下文中声明它:
问题内容: 在包中的某个动作内,是否可以在range动作之前访问管道值,或者是否可以将父/全局管道作为参数传递给Execute? 工作示例显示了我尝试执行的操作: play.golang.org 问题答案: 使用$变量(推荐) 从软件包文本/模板文档中: 开始执行时,将$设置为传递给Execute的数据参数,即dot的起始值。 正如@Sandy所指出的,因此可以使用来访问外部作用域中的Path 。
本文向大家介绍vue 实现一个简单的全局调用弹窗案例,包括了vue 实现一个简单的全局调用弹窗案例的使用技巧和注意事项,需要的朋友参考一下 1.实现效果图 2.第一步,新建一个.vue文件 定义一个弹框的基本模板 style样式放在了文章的最底部,如果需要看效果,需要将样式放入这个vue文件里,样式是用less写的,需要你的项目引入less 注意:我这里的组件右上角关闭是一张图片 需要换成你自己本